In 2021, Wrightsville, GA had a population of 3.36k people with a median age of 36.9 and a median household income of $28,327.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Wrightsville, GA declined from 3,638 to 3,362, a −7.59% decrease and its median household income grew from $26,250 to $28,327, a 7.91%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Wrightsville, GA are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(58.5%), White (Non-Hispanic) (36.5%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(1.78%), Two+ (Hispanic) (1.1%), and Other (Hispanic) (0.863%).
None of the households in Wrightsville, GA re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
99.4% of the residents in Wrightsville, GA are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Wrightsville, GA was $62,600, and the homeownership rate was 66.3%.
Most people in Wrightsville, GA dr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 31.1 minutes. The average car ownership in Wrightsville, GA was 2 cars per household.
